Impinj R705 Portal Gateway Reader Installation and Operations Guide For client control of the gateway, the gateway supports the EPCglobal Low Level Reader Protocol (LLRP) v1.0.1. LLRP is an EPCglobal standard interface that allows communication with the gateway, which in turn reads EPCglobal Gen 2 RFID tags. 1.10 Power Requirements The RF transmit power is limited by the type of power supplied (PoE, or PoE+). Impinj R705 Portal Gateway Reader Installation and Operations Guide The antenna ports are located opposite the interface. 2.2 Connect the gateway to the network The network connection serves a dual purpose, as it supplies both data connectivity and power. To power the gateway with the Ethernet connection, there are two options: • If your network switch directly provides PoE or PoE+, simply connect to the switch with an Ethernet cable.

However, if the IPv6 address is not available when the gateway is booting, but the IPv4 address is available, then Octane will choose an IPv4 address. You can confirm which IP address the gateway is using for the LLRP connection via either the Web UI or the RShell console (using the “show network summary” command).
